A **SAN (Storage Area Network)** is a dedicated high-speed network that provides block-level storage access by connecting servers to storage devices such as disk arrays, tape libraries, and optical jukeboxes. This specialized network architecture enables organizations to consolidate storage resources and improve data management efficiency in enterprise environments.
Key Components and Architecture
- Storage devices (disk arrays, tape libraries)
- Dedicated network infrastructure
- Host bus adapters (HBAs)
- SAN switches and directors
- Storage management software

The architecture allows multiple servers to access shared storage pools, making it ideal for enterprise-scale deployments and virtualized environments.
Benefits and Applications
- Improved storage utilization and scalability
- Enhanced backup and disaster recovery capabilities
- Better performance through dedicated storage networking
- Centralized storage management
- Support for server clustering and virtualization

Security Considerations
- Zoning and LUN masking
- Fabric isolation
- Authentication and access control
- Encryption of data in transit
- Regular security audits and monitoring
Modern SANs typically support both Fibre Channel and iSCSI protocols, providing flexibility in deployment options while maintaining enterprise-grade performance and reliability.
